 the current winding, as long as the current direction corresponds to the operation of the conveyor motor as a motor, but it supports the voltage coil in its effect as soon as it works as a generator. By setting the spring force and corresponding dimensions of the individual windings, it is now possible to bring about the above-mentioned mode of action. In order to prevent that in the event of the absence of the excitation current of the voltage winding, the current coil is also in the positive sense in the current direction of the conveyor motor, i.e. i. if the same is working as a motor, locking the emergency stop switch, precautions can be taken in a known manner, which then render the current winding ineffective.

   PATENT CLAIMS:
1. Device for de-energizing electrical hoisting machines operated in Leonard control, in which a switching device known per se to reduce the amount of the
 EMI2.3
 effect of any force is actuated, characterized in that the reduction in the starting dynamo voltage takes place until the conveyor motor returns a braking current of a certain magnitude to the starting dynamo according to its speed, whereas the further reduction in the starting dynamo voltage depending on the braking current of the conveyor motor is known Medium is regulated until the engine comes to a standstill.
